H*4319 (Rat #0162, Act #0148 of 2022) General Bill, By Calhoon, Huggins, Erickson, McCabe, Henderson-Myers, Crawford, Oremus, Henegan, McGarry, Matthews, Dillard, Allison, Bernstein, McDaniel, Murray, Felder, Bennett, R. Williams, Jefferson, Alexander and Kirby
Summary: DMV-Real ID compliant driver's license
    AN ACT TO AMEND SECTION 56-1-90, CODE OF LAWS OF SOUTH CAROLINA, 1976, RELATING TO EVIDENCE REQUIRED OF APPLICANTS TO OBTAIN A DRIVER'S LICENSE, SO AS TO REVISE THIS EVIDENCE TO INCLUDE GENDER, PRINCIPAL RESIDENTIAL ADDRESS, LEGAL NAME CHANGE, AND AUTHORIZED LENGTH OF STAY IN THIS COUNTRY, TO PROVIDE THIS EVIDENCE APPLIES TO APPLICANTS SEEKING TO OBTAIN OR RENEW DRIVERS' LICENSES, BEGINNERS' PERMITS, OR IDENTIFICATION CARDS, TO REVISE THE TYPES OF EVIDENCE NECESSARY TO VERIFY THE SOCIAL SECURITY NUMBERS OF APPLICANTS, TO PROVIDE THE TYPES OF EVIDENCE APPLICANTS WHOSE NAMES HAVE CHANGED SINCE BIRTH MUST PRESENT TO SHOW NAME TRACEABILITY, TO PROVIDE APPLICANTS MAY HAVE DRIVERS' LICENSES OR IDENTIFICATION CARDS ISSUED IN THEIR PREFERRED NAMES UNDER CERTAIN CIRCUMSTANCES, AND TO PROVIDE THAT REAL IDS SHALL NOT BE ISSUED IN THE CASE OF SOCIAL SECURITY NUMBERS NOT VALIDATING; AND TO AMEND SECTIONS 56-1-140, AS AMENDED, 56-1-50, AS AMENDED, 56-1-2100, AS AMENDED, AND 56-1-3370, RELATING TO THE ISSUANCE OF DRIVERS' LICENSES, BEGINNERS' PERMITS, COMMERCIAL DRIVER LICENSES, AND SPECIAL IDENTIFICATION CARDS, SO AS TO PROVIDE THEY MUST CONTAIN UNOBSTRUCTED PHOTOGRAPHS OF THE APPLICANTS, AND TO PROVIDE THE PHOTOGRAPHS ARE NOT REQUIRED TO BE IN COLOR. - ratified title
